Nagoya Station Kaihatsu announced that it will start construction in April on a complex it is developing at the east exit of JR Okazaki Station, aiming to open in the spring of 2026.
The steel-framed, partly wooden, three-story building with a site area of approximately 1,000 m2 and a total floor area of approximately 1,500 m2 will house nine tenants, including restaurants, retail shops, and medical facilities convenient for daily life.
The facility is connected to the bus rotary in the station square and the pedestrian deck above the bus rotary, and adopts a simple design based on silver tones that harmonizes with the station platform. The facility will enhance the circulation around the station and create a lively atmosphere in the town.
The name of the facility, tenants, and opening date will be announced at a later date.
